Across the available record, Starbucks Coffee No 48803 has four inspections on file, the first dated 2023. The most recent report on file is from Feb 17, 2026. When a facility lands in medium risk territory, it usually means a mixed inspection result.

Compared to the prior visit, inspectors found more to write up: six violations versus two before.

The pattern that stands out is physical facilities installed, maintained, & clean, which has been cited three times.

Restaurants in Johnston average 77, so Starbucks Coffee No 48803 trails the local norm. The inspection history reads as standard for a restaurant of this size.

Inspection History
Feb 17, 2026
Routine
2 major violations. 4 minor violations. 1 corrected on site.
View 6 violations
Warewashing facilities; installed maintained, & used; test strips
Inspector notes: The facility is lacking thermo labels or similar internal temperature indicating device for the dish machine.
4-302.13
Handwashing sink blocked, inaccessible, or used improperly (corrected on site)
Inspector notes: Inspector observed ice and coffee debris in the handwashing sink in the kitchen area next to ice machine. A hand-washing sink must not be used for purposes other than hand washing. PIC informed staff to use designated dumps sinks to dump beverages during inspection.
5-205.11
Physical facilities not in good repair
Inspector notes: The walls in the back hallway area and behind dishwasher is in poor repair (holes observed). The physical facilities must be maintained in good repair.
6-501.11
Mops not properly air-dried after use
Inspector notes: Mops must be allowed to air dry after use.
6-501.16
Garbage & refuse properly disposed: facilities maintained
Inspector notes: Inspector observed bags of trash and debris around shared dumpster area. PIC informed to keep area clean.
5-501.115
Physical facilities not cleaned at required frequency
Inspector notes: The floors throughout the facility have an accumulation of soil residue and/or food debris. The physical facilities shall be cleaned as often as necessary to keep them clean.
6-501.12
